Full job description
Overview
We are seeking a skilled Welder/Fabricator to join our manufacturing team. In this role, you will fabricate high-end metal details, complex weldments, and architectural facade products. This is a custom manufacturing environment, not a repetitive assembly line. You will work from blueprints and engineering drawings, weld a variety of materials—specifically Steel, Aluminum, and Stainless—and ensure every piece meets rigorous aesthetic and structural standards. We are looking for hands-on builders who bring a strong work ethic to the floor and enjoy the challenge of creating visible, high-impact work.
Profiles encouraged to apply include: experienced metal fabricators, custom job-shop welders, structural fitters, architectural metalworkers, and detail-oriented tradespeople who enjoy the challenge of working with different metals and complex geometries.

- Execute Precision MIG & TIG Welding – Perform high-quality MIG and TIG welding on Aluminum, Stainless Steel, and Carbon Steel. You must be able to adapt to a variety of thicknesses and positions to meet the visual and structural requirements of architectural work.
- Fabricate Architectural Metals & Facades – Interpret engineering drawings, weld symbols, bills of materials, and diagrams to accurately layout, fit, and fabricate complex architectural weldments and facade components.
- Ensure High-End Finish Quality – Because much of our work is visible (architectural), you must produce clean welds and utilize grinders/finish tools to meet strict aesthetic specifications.
- Operate Fabrication Tools and Equipment – Utilize handheld tools (grinders, weld stud guns) and heavy machinery (forklifts, overhead cranes) to manipulate large metal components safely and efficiently.
- Perform In-Process Quality Inspections – Use calipers, weld gauges, tape measures, and other precision tools to verify geometric accuracy; identify defects early and rework as needed to meet specifications.
- Maintain Equipment and Work Area – Perform preventative maintenance on weld machines, create specific setups/fixtures for unique builds, and keep the workspace clean and safe.
- Model Professional Shop Behavior – Work effectively in a team environment, respect all teammates, and demonstrate self-motivation and high attention to detail.
